Runbook bit — ScaleSpoon, our recipe-scaling calculator. If a plugin reports wonky yields (e.g., doubling a recipe triples the flour), it's almost always a unit-registry mismatch between your plugin and the core service. Restarting the converter worker usually clears it; if not, check that your plugin targets the same registry version we do. To verify, compare your setup against the live service values below.

service settings:
PRAWYN_PIN=9848
PRAWYN_METRICS_HOST=metrics.prawyn.lumicworks.corp
PRAWYN_LOG_LEVEL=warn
PRAWYN_TENANT=pelius

## Releases

Lintquill releases ship on the first Tuesday of each month. Run `lintquill check --strict` against the docs tree before tagging. Tags follow `vMAJOR.MINOR.PATCH`. Do not cut a release with open blocker issues in the Fennel board. CI builds the tarball, runs the rule regression suite, and publishes to the Orchard mirror. All release artifacts must be signed or the mirror rejects them. Ask Priya if the pipeline stalls. Sign tags with the following key.

deploy key for kahof-tadup: bky4_rRMZ

Ticket: Consent banner rollout on Meridale's Tidepool app is stalled at 40% of traffic. The banner renders correctly on first load but reappears after locale switches because the preference cookie is scoped to the old subdomain. QA confirmed the regression only on staged builds behind the Larkspur edge proxy. Proposed fix rewrites cookie scope at the gateway; legal review of wording is already complete. For the sync, the staged build token is pasted below.

pipeline stamp: htk9_ce63042d9